The government is pushing e-jeepneys as the future of Philippine public transport at P2.8 million per unit. But when drivers net P200 to P500 a day, who exactly is this modernization serving? This piece breaks down the policy architecture, the financing gap, the price markup problem, and why local manufacturers can build compliant units for under P1 million while Chinese imports dominate the program.
